Help for Tinnitus Sufferers
from: Jason Rickard There are a few ways to help with the constant sounds that you are plagued with.
Most people only notice these annoying ringing sounds or whooshing sounds when everything is quiet, like at night when you are trying to go to sleep. There are a few ways to combat the ringing to get a peaceful nights sleep.
If you notice while you are in the shower or listening to other music your Tinnitus is better. You will find that soft sounds such as from the shower or ocean waves can relieve some of the sounds associated with Tinnitus. You can find some wonderful CD’s with which you can use earphones and listen during episodes of tinnitus. You can even just listen to them without earphones at night while you are going to sleep. These CD’s will help relieve Tinnitus and you will love the peaceful nights rest.
Other remedies you can try include cutting out alcohol, smoking or caffeine. These items have proven to make tinnitus worse. Salt should also be cut down in your diet as it causes a build up of fluid in your ears.
Try to keep the noise level in your daily routine to a minimum or wear ear plugs if you can not avoid the noise.
Cut down on taking aspirin. Aspirin may worsen the affects of Tinnitus in some people.
Stress was found to increase tinnitus. So of course try to avoid stressful situations and learn to handle the stress that is in your life. Distraction is another great way of receiving some relief. Focus on something other than the noise in your ears.
Relaxation tapes like the CD’s mentioned about are a great distraction and will also relieve stress. So, you can use them to help yourself relax as well as combat tinnitus.
